Why Sociology?
Sociology examines the social, cultural, and historical influences that shape our lives and the world in which we live.
Why Bay College?
The Sociology program at Bay College provides students with a perspective that allows them to consider the "bigger picture" of society and their place within it. Students majoring in Sociology should follow the Associate in Arts degree before transferring to pursue a bachelor's degree. Below are topics commonly found in most sociology courses:
- Institutions
- Globalization
- Deviance, Crime, and Social Control
- Gender, Social Class, and Race/Ethnicity
- Group Dynamics
- Religion
- Marriage and Family Life
